I’ve wanted to march drum corps since my junior year of high school, but I’ve never been able to put together the money to actually audition for a corps, let alone pay for tour fees. Now that I’m technically an adult and have a job, I’ve been putting away money to march the few years that I have left until I age out. Since I’ve grown, I’ve realized that summer band is very pricey and in my honest opinion, I don’t think you should accept a contract if you know cannot fulfill your financial obligations. While that’s harsh thing to say, you are potentially robbing someone else of the opportunity to live out their dream. You are giving staff false hope, and knowingly taking a spot that’ll be empty come April or May, when most cut rookies are resigned to a summer with the Couchmen. I’d rather not march a year than burden others with my fiscal responsibilities that I should take care of before stepping on the field. Do NOT walk into an audition camp and accept a contract you can’t pay for. Do NOT rely on crowdfunding and the generosity of others to pay for something you are passionate about. And don’t you ever fucking dare be so selfish to take a spot others were cut for, only to give it up because you didn’t have your things together when the time came.
